## Timezone Handling in Exports (Chartbay)

Plugin authors: Chartbay normalizes all timestamps to UTC internally and converts at render time using the workspace timezone, never the server's. Do not apply offsets yourself; double conversion is the top export bug we see. The exporter reads its timezone behavior from the following configuration.

config for bawig-fadup:
[zorix]
host = zorix.lumicworks.corp
user = zorix_svc
database = zorix_prod

## Idempotency Keys for Payment Retries (Lumopay)

Every retry of a charge request must reuse the original idempotency key; generating a new key on retry can produce duplicate charges. Keys are scoped per merchant and expire after 48 hours. Reviewers should verify keys are derived server-side, never from client input. The full key-generation specification and threat model are maintained on the internal page.

dashboard of kaguf-tawip = https://vault.merlaqsys.test/issue

Handover — Vexler partner SFTP drop

Ownership moves to you today. Drop runs hourly from Vexler's end into the intake bucket via the relay host. Watch for zero-byte files; their exporter flakes on Mondays. Creds live in the ops vault, path noted in the runbook. Vault auto-seals after 48h idle. Support escalations go to the on-call rotation, not me. If the vault is sealed when you need it, unseal with the recovery passphrase below.

recovery phrase for tadug-fafof: zorwyn-kasion

Hey release folks,

Quick heads up for support: we're shipping a fix to Splitwing, our A/B experiment assignment service. A handful of users on the Lumora dashboard were getting re-bucketed mid-session, which explains those weird "my layout keeps changing" tickets. That's patched — assignments are now sticky for the full session window.

If customers still report flip-flopping after tonight, escalate with a screenshot and the timestamp. For reference, the token for this build is below.

build token for kagaf-hahof: htk14_9d3d4d26d7d8de